1 Targeted proteomic signatures differentiate molecular classes of uveal melanoma: a The vitreous contains native vitreous proteins, systemic protein biomarkers, and tumor biomarkers that can be sampled through proteomic analysis. Our research has demonstrated that retinal proteins leak into the vitreous, and that proteomic analysis of vitreous biopsies can detect molecular changes in the adjacent retina, uncover biomarkers, and identify protein targets for adjuvant therapy [[6]].
